Research Abstract

The purpose of this research is to explore the possible factors to determine the electoral outcome of the female candidates running for the national level assemblies in the United States of America, Scotland and Japan. We focus the elections of the 2005 Lower House Election in Japan, the 2006 Mid-Term Election in the United States, and the 2007 Election in the Scottish Parliament.
Research shows the importance of the electoral systems as one of the most decisive factors for the women candidates to be successful. The barriers of the electoral systems against the women's successes are the strong incumbency and the length of the legislative term. Many states adopted the term-limits for the reelection of the candidates to the state assemblies, but this measure did not necessarily work for the women to be elected
The most effective measure to increase women's presence in the legislative bodies is the gender quota system. The research explores the arguments of pros and cons of the system, and shows the necessary and sufficient conditions in adopting the quota system for the elections of the minority members of the society, such as women, to the policy-making bodies.
